About the Nursing Home

Raheny Community Nursing Unit is a nursing home located on Harmonstown Road in Raheny, Co. Dublin, Ireland. It provides residential care for elderly people in need of long-term care. The facility offers a wide range of services, including 24-hour nursing care, physiotherapy, occupational therapy, and recreational activities. The staff is highly trained and experienced in providing quality care to their residents. The home also has a variety of amenities, such as a library, a chapel, a garden, and a café. Raheny Community Nursing Unit is committed to providing a safe and comfortable environment for its residents. The home is dedicated to providing the best possible care and support to its residents and their families.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What types of care and services are provided?

Raheny Community Nursing Unit provides a wide range of care and services to its residents. They offer 24-hour nursing care, physiotherapy, occupational therapy, speech and language therapy, social activities, and recreational activities. They also provide personal care, such as assistance with dressing, bathing, and grooming. They have a team of qualified and experienced staff who are dedicated to providing the highest quality of care and services to their residents. They also provide a range of dietary options to meet the needs of their residents.

Does this nursing home accept the Fair Deal scheme?

Yes, Raheny Community Nursing Unit accepts the Fair Deal scheme. They provide quality care and services to their residents.

What is the visiting policy?

Raheny Community Nursing Unit offers a visiting policy that is designed to ensure the safety and well-being of their residents. They allow visitors to come to the nursing home during the day, with visiting hours from 10am until 8pm. Visitors are asked to check in at the reception desk upon arrival and to follow the guidelines and protocols set out by the nursing home. All visitors must adhere to social distancing and hygiene measures, such as wearing a face covering and using hand sanitizer. They also ask visitors to limit the number of people visiting at any one time.
